May 2025 - Apr 2026Hilary Avenue area has the 13th lowest crime rate of 77 local areas in Cosham , and the 45th lowest crime rate of 578 local areas in Portsmouth .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Hilary Avenue (PO6 2PP) in the last 12 months was 18.9 per 1,000 residents and was 86.4% lower than the Cosham average (139.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Criminal damage and arson with 3 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violent crimes ( -66.7%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 1 (≈ 2.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-66.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-80.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Hilary Avenue (PO6 2PP), the main crime hotspot is near Lindisfarne Close. Police recorded 14 crimes here, including 11 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
